Biological forecasting

Biological forecasting results for the forthcoming decades are compiled for 14 ClimeFish case studies. Biological changes in biomass, catch, growth rate, etc. are reported in response to water temperature changes. The impact of fishing mortality is also considered in all fishery case studies (8 of 14 cases). Other managerial drivers such as feeding, stocking time or stocking density are reported in aquaculture case studies. One data file is provided for each case study, which contain a sheet with metadata information followed by one or several sheets with the forecasting data. The equivalence between ClimeFish case study code and name is the following: C1F: NE Atlantic pelagic fisheries C2F: Baltic Sea pelagic fisheries C3F: Baltic Sea demersal fisheries C5F: W of Scotland demersal fisheries C6F: Adriatic Sea demersal fisheries C7F: Norwegian fresh cold water fisheries C8F: Lake Garda fresh cold water fisheries C9F: Czech lakes fresh warm water fisheries C10A: Hungarian ponds aquaculture C11A: Norwegian Salmon aquaculture C12A: Greek sea bass aquaculture C13A: Galician shellfish aquaculture C14A: W Scotland shellfish aquaculture C15A: Northern Adriatic shellfish aquaculture
